Focus on diversity: open experience stand for Biodiversity Day

In early summer, when we once again enjoy the blooming, singing, croaking and hopping life all around us, the International Day of Biodiversity is just around the corner. This day of action was set by the United Nations in 2001 on 22 May. It reminds us of the Convention on Biological Diversity (CBD), which was signed by more than 190 countries in 1992 to protect biodiversity.

To celebrate this day, visit the Museum of Nature and experience the fascinating and beautiful diversity of species here and in other parts of the world. Learn more about the reasons why it is so important for us humans to preserve it!
